Transaction 17308fe58fe4f9981ccefd750d275f523a0ade0270ab6e1eeb8f4a3aa74c861e

2 Input
1 Outputs
  • 17308fe58fe4f9981ccefd750d275f523a0ade0270ab6e1eeb8f4a3aa74c861e:0
  • value  21699472
    address  3KksTw7CLS36s1h23SdRypRaor8W4EDL16